Leron Jackson played for the worst team in 5A and perhaps all of Kentucky. The Raiders played 11-games and got drilled 11-times. The Raiders “high water” mark for the year was dropping a game to Trimble County on September 22 by three TDs. That doesn’t mean Keith May doesn’t have some great players in the “hopper.” Matter of fact, Coach May may (pardon the pun) be developing ’27’s premier LB and perhaps its best player at any position. His name is Leron Jackson and he had quite the freshman season. Enjoy the feature. Friday Night Fletch.

The Johnson kid (Zane) has defied all conventional wisdom generally espoused about playing as a freshman at Louisville’s Trinity High. Not only is he playing, but his play has resulted in Trinity winning. Before you call and tell me your son should be the Freshman All-State QB there are some performances out there you might want to see prior to your getting too far out on that limb. Enjoy the feature.
